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blazed Luzon Chrotomys | Chestnut Weeper Capuchin |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Cebidae |
| Genus | Chrotomys | Cebus |
| Species | Chrotomys silaceus | Cebus castaneus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Blazed Luzon Chrotomys and Chestnut Weeper Capuchin share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
